    17" monitor on a 8 year old piece of shit gateway computer.. I can't run HUD if I have more than 12 tables open because I lag to hell. Really looking forward to a new computer... that'll be my first gift to myself once I am beating 100nl.

    Ring games
    9 tables at once for 6 max.. don't really play FR

    SNGs
    When playing sngs I typically play sets of 20 or 30 stacked... 9 tiled if I am working on my game. The most SNGs I have played at once is 60. I don't recommend more than 40 in regular sngs and 30 for turbos, though.

    MTTs
    I never play more than 4 at once.. 2 is the sweet spot. You have to make so many damn moves in MTTs its hard to do this properly with more than 4 tables.

    One thing that might help you out if you want to multi-table if you have a shit computer (like i do) is to turn off the animation. I know you can do it on stars by going into the options. All it does is turn off the cards being dealt from the table and it makes them just appear. I like it better and you lag alot less if your videocard is crap.
